更新时间:2024-05-14 GMT+08:00
分享

校验上传数据的一致性

为了验证用户上传数据的完整性和正确性,可根据自己的业务场景选择以下任意一种方式进行校验。详情请参考此链接

方式一:使用OBS Browser+校验上传数据的一致性

OBS Browser+默认关闭MD5校验,在OBS Browser+上启用MD5校验一致性并上传数据的步骤如下:

  1. 登录OBS Browser+。
  2. 单击客户端右上方的,并选择“高级设置”。
  3. 勾选“MD5校验”,如图1所示。
    图1 配置MD5校验
  4. 单击“确定”。
  5. 选择待上传文件的桶,上传文件。
    • 若MD5校验成功,则文件上传成功。
    • 若MD5校验失败,则文件上传失败,且在任务管理中提示失败原因:校验文件MD5失败。

方式二:使用obsutil校验上传数据的一致性

obsutil支持在上传数据时通过附加参数(vmd5)来校验数据的一致性。

以在Windows操作系统上传本地一个位于D盘的test.txt文件至mytestbucket桶为例,开启一致性校验的命令示例如下:

obsutil cp D:\test.txt obs://mytestbucket/test.txt -vmd5

校验通过后,数据上传成功,系统显示Upload successfully的回显信息。

图2 obsutil校验
分享:

    相关文档

    相关产品